Jakie są kluczowe cechy MySQL?
Najważniejsze funkcje MySQL obejmują:
- Integracja z SQL: MySQL jest kompatybilny z SQL, co czyni go szeroko rozpoznawalnym bazy danych narzędziem do zarządzania.
- Optymalizacja wydajności: MySQL został zaprojektowany do pracy z dużymi zbiorami danych; dlatego szybkość i wydajność są kluczowymi cechami MySQL.
- MySQL może dynamicznie dostosowywać swoją pojemność do wzrostu ilości danych i wymagań użytkowników.
- Integralność danych: MySQL traktuje priorytetowo integralność danych, zapewniając spójny i niezawodny dostęp do przechowywanych informacji, minimalizując ryzyko niedokładnych lub niekompletnych danych.
Jakie są najczęstsze przypadki użycia MySQL?
MySQL może być używany do różnych rodzajów aplikacji i sam w sobie jest bazą danych, a najczęstsze przypadki użycia obejmują:
- Tworzenie stron internetowych: MySQL umożliwia funkcjonowanie wielu stron internetowych i aplikacji internetowych, przechowując m.in. dane kont użytkowników i katalogów.
- Analiza danych: Naukowcy i analitycy mogą podejmować świadome decyzje, korzystając z MySQL do przeszukiwania dużych zbiorów danych w celu identyfikacji trendów i uzyskiwania wglądu.
- Systemy zarządzania: Zarządzanie bazami danych MySQL jest kluczowe dla popularnych platform CMS.
Jak MySQL wypada w porównaniu z innymi popularnymi bazami danych, takimi jak PostgreSQL i Oracle?
Łatwość obsługi, wydajność i przystępna cena MySQL sprawiają, że jest to popularny wybór dla wielu użytkowników, podczas gdy aplikacje wymagające bardziej wyspecjalizowanych funkcji mogą uznać PostgreSQL lub Oracle za bardziej odpowiednie alternatywy, pomimo ich złożoności.
Jaka jest historia MySQL?
Rozwój MySQL jako bazy danych dla aplikacji internetowych rozpoczął się na początku lat 90. XX wieku. Możliwe, że szerokie zastosowanie MySQL wynika z jego skupienia się na czynnikach takich jak wydajność, niezawodność i prostota. W 2005 roku Sun Microsystems kupił MySQL, a następnie Oracle nabył go około pięć lat później, w 2010 roku.
Jaki jest model licencjonowania MySQL?
Dostęp do MySQL można uzyskać za pomocą dwóch opcji licencjonowania:
- Serwer społecznościowy: Ta darmowa wersja jest dostępna publicznie i służy do różnych zadań ogólnego przeznaczenia.
- Wersja korporacyjna: Oferuje dodatkowe funkcje i spersonalizowane wsparcie, ale wymaga opłaty abonamentowej.
Czym są MySQL Community Server i MySQL Enterprise Edition?
Dwie wersje MySQL różnią się licencjami i funkcjami, takimi jak:
Serwer społecznościowy MySQL:
- Kluczową cechą korzystania z oprogramowania open-source jest brak ograniczeń własnościowych i zobowiązań finansowych.
- Dotyczy większości opracowanych typów oprogramowania.
- Zapewnia podstawowe funkcje i możliwości.
Wersja korporacyjna MySQL:
- Dostępne do zakupu z dodatkowymi ulepszeniami.
- Oferuje funkcje nadzorowania, duplikowania i ulepszania dostępności usług dzięki zaawansowanym możliwościom.
- Oferuje obsługę klienta i pomoc techniczną.
Podsumowanie
Tworzenie stron internetowych i zarządzanie danymi to jedne z wielu obszarów zastosowania MySQL jako systemu zarządzania bazami danych. Chociaż interfejs może nie być najmodniejszy, jest prosty i zapewnia stabilną wydajność w swojej cenie. Rozumiejąc podstawowe funkcje MySQL, osoby bez rozległej wiedzy lub doświadczenia w tworzeniu stron internetowych mogą go używać do zarządzania danymi.